Stéphane De Wit
About
Stéphane De Wit has authored 50 papers that have received a total of 7.2k indexed citations.
This includes 41 papers in Infectious Diseases, 19 papers in Epidemiology and 18 papers in Emergency Medicine. The topics of these papers are H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(23 papers), Prevention and Treatment of HIV/AIDS Infection (21 papers) and HIV Research and Treatment (18 papers). Stéphane De Wit is often cited by papers focused on H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(23 papers), Prevention and Treatment of HIV/AIDS Infection (21 papers) and HIV Research and Treatment (18 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, United Kingdom and Denmark. Stéphane De Wit's co-authors include Jens Lundgren, Peter Reiss, Antonella d’Arminio Monforte, Caroline Sabin and Matthew Law and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, The Lancet and Circulation.
